AURORA — Officials have ticketed the driver of a car that struck an Aurora police SUV on its way to a call. Richard Lee Williams, 73, of Englewood was cited for failing to yield the right-of-way to an emergency vehicle, Aurora police said Tuesday.

About 5 p.m. Saturday, Sgt. Walt Obrecht was driving a marked 2007 Ford Expedition police car with lights and siren on headed east on East Colfax Avenue, getting ready to turn left onto Tower Road.

Other cars stopped, but Williams did not, and hit the SUV broadside, police said.
